Review: Battle of the lip crayons

You may have been living under a rock if you aren't aware about the current trend of lip crayons. These products are definitely the latest craze on the beauty market, and I am no exception to all the beauty lovers that are getting their hands on these products.

I am aware that there are countless brands that are producing these products; Clinique, Bourjois, Jordana, Covergirl, Laura Mercier - the list could go on forever. Like many full time uni students, I am beauty obsessed on a budget. While I would love to own some of the higher end lip crayons, today I have five different brands available from the 'drugstore' that I am going to compare. I'll try to keep it short with a few descriptions about each brands product.

Revlon Just Bitten Kissable Balm Stains


L-R: Honey, Cherish, Darling, Lovesick, Adore & Rendezvous
Swatches L-R in same order as above photo
About Just Bitten Kissable Balm Stains:
  • Seem to be the most hyped up lip crayons on the market
  • A sheer but buildable glossy product that leaves a stain once the gloss wears off
  • Wear time for gloss is about 2 hours, but the stain lasts for about 6 hours in my experience
  • Available in 12 colours
  • Has a minty scent to it, which I unfortunately don't like, but it's not offputting and can't be smelled once applied
  • Retailed at $17.95AUD


Boe Beauty 'Jumbo Lips'


L-R: Boudoir Pink, Better Bare, Knockout Red, Unknown colour name (doesn't have a label) & Manic Pink

L-R swatches in above order
About:
  • Exclusive to Big W at $2AUD
  • A relatively pigmented gloss that has a slight stain 
  • Minimal wear time: 2+ hours
  • Available in 5 colours (all of which are pictured above)
  • Packaging is reasonable and has a silver bottom to twist product like the Revlon crayons. Lid isn't very secure though.
  • Perhaps a slight synthetic smell, but no real scent to it
  • Lip crayon itself is quite flimsy, and I unfortunately had the tip break off my favourite one, 'Manic Pink' (swatch is on the right in photo, was very messy to apply)

Models Prefer 'Moisture Lust Glossy Lip Tint'

L-R: Black Cherry, Raspberry Ripple, Marshmallow & Toffee Fudge


Swatches L-R same as above order

Also experienced breakage with the MP crayon :(
About: 
  • Is a 'lip tint', so they are quite sheer and add coloured, glossy sheen to the lip
  • Packaging is literally identical to the Boe beauty crayons
  • Exclusive to Priceline; I bought these in 2x packs for $5, making them $2.50AUD each
  • Crayon itself is not as wide as the packaging, meaning the product slides from side to side as you apply it. This combined with the fact that you need to press down to build up the colour unfortunately resulted in a breakage of one of them. Haha, maybe I'm just too rough with these lip crayons! 
  • A very feint synthetic scent to them (virtually non-existent)
  • Wear time is at most about 2-3 hours

Face of Australia Glossy Lip Crayon

L-R: Berry Brulee, Raspberry Coulis & Pie La Mode



About:

  • A relatively pigmented glossy sheen
  • Retails for $4.95 at Priceline
  • Weartime is decent, 3+ hours and wears off evenly
  • Favourite is definitely Berry Brulee - a bright purple/plum colour
  • Packaging is sturdy and much better than the Boe and Models Prefer packaging
  • Very nice vanilla scent



Designer Brands Chubby Lip Crayon

410 Doll Face



About:
  • I only own one of these lip crayons, so this is based on the one colour I own
  • This formula is more like a creamy lipstick that dries semi-matte, unlike all of the other crayons above that are sheer buildable glosses
  • Extremely pigmented and only need one or two swipes on the lip
  • Much thinner and longer than all of the other brands, but still contains the typical silver twist up bottom
  • No detectable scent
  • Retails for $8AUD

Overall opinions

While I do love a standard lipstick, these are a fun new lip product that I'm really enjoying. I think the classic rules applies in this case: 'You get what you pay for'. 
My favourite are definitely the Revlon Balm Stains, as they provide a nice glossy, pigmented lip but wear off evenly and leave a nice stain. The Designer Brands lip crayon is really nice and bright and looks like a regular lipstick on the lips. The Boe beauty products are easy to wear and are are quite pigmented for the price, but are cheap quality. I am not a huge fan of the Models Prefer crayons, but are still easy to wear if I am just going out for a couple of hours and am not concerned about wear time. The Face of Australia crayons are super glossy and pigmented and I've really been loving those.

I will definitely be on the hunt for some more of these from various brands.
